Hi

This allows the use of custom CC, such as clang's static analyzer.

- Lauri
>From b28f843a2faacc572bb8ae33cff73c62c4ef86cb Mon Sep 17 00:00:00 2001
From: Lauri Kasanen <[email protected]>
Date: Wed, 23 May 2012 17:08:52 +0300
Subject: [PATCH] build system: don't override user's CC if set


Signed-off-by: Lauri Kasanen <[email protected]>
---
 configure                      |    2 +-
 plugins/auth/Makefile.in       |    2 +-
 plugins/cheetah/Makefile.in    |    2 +-
 plugins/dirlisting/Makefile.in |    2 +-
 plugins/liana/Makefile.in      |    2 +-
 plugins/liana_ssl/Makefile.in  |    2 +-
 plugins/logger/Makefile.in     |    2 +-
 plugins/mandril/Makefile.in    |    2 +-
 plugins/palm/Makefile.in       |    2 +-
 9 files changed, 9 insertions(+), 9 deletions(-)

diff --git a/configure b/configure
index 4197f36..9ae685f 100755
--- a/configure
+++ b/configure
@@ -419,7 +419,7 @@ fi
 
 cat > src/Makefile<<EOF
 _PATH   = \$(patsubst \$(monkey_root)/%, %, \$(CURDIR))
-CC     = @echo "  CC   \$(_PATH)/\$@"; $CC
+CC     ?= @echo "  CC   \$(_PATH)/\$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 DEFS    = $DEFS
diff --git a/plugins/auth/Makefile.in b/plugins/auth/Makefile.in
index 59d9685..dad0112 100644
--- a/plugins/auth/Makefile.in
+++ b/plugins/auth/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/cheetah/Makefile.in b/plugins/cheetah/Makefile.in
index f3d9813..8068960 100644
--- a/plugins/cheetah/Makefile.in
+++ b/plugins/cheetah/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/dirlisting/Makefile.in b/plugins/dirlisting/Makefile.in
index c1017d1..c030add 100644
--- a/plugins/dirlisting/Makefile.in
+++ b/plugins/dirlisting/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/liana/Makefile.in b/plugins/liana/Makefile.in
index c7922d4..8e09f0b 100644
--- a/plugins/liana/Makefile.in
+++ b/plugins/liana/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/liana_ssl/Makefile.in b/plugins/liana_ssl/Makefile.in
index f00df23..d3acfb6 100644
--- a/plugins/liana_ssl/Makefile.in
+++ b/plugins/liana_ssl/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/logger/Makefile.in b/plugins/logger/Makefile.in
index 2e99fea..3debe7c 100644
--- a/plugins/logger/Makefile.in
+++ b/plugins/logger/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/mandril/Makefile.in b/plugins/mandril/Makefile.in
index 2f9f749..1e3ce85 100644
--- a/plugins/mandril/Makefile.in
+++ b/plugins/mandril/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
diff --git a/plugins/palm/Makefile.in b/plugins/palm/Makefile.in
index ed57080..e28f476 100644
--- a/plugins/palm/Makefile.in
+++ b/plugins/palm/Makefile.in
@@ -1,5 +1,5 @@
 _PATH   = $(patsubst $(monkey_root)/%, %, $(CURDIR))
-CC     = @echo "  CC   $(_PATH)/$@"; $CC
+CC     ?= @echo "  CC   $(_PATH)/$@"; $CC
 CC_QUIET= @echo -n; $CC
 CFLAGS = $CFLAGS
 LDFLAGS = $LDFLAGS
-- 
1.7.2.1

_______________________________________________
Monkey mailing list
[email protected]
http://lists.monkey-project.com/listinfo/monkey

Reply via email to